What Are Rolling Papers?

Rolling papers are thin sheets of paper, often made from plant fibers, designed to encase and smoke materials like tobacco or cannabis. They are a crucial component of the smoking experience, and their quality can significantly impact the overall enjoyment. The material composition of a rolling paper—be it hemp, rice, flax, or wood pulp—defines its core characteristics.

  • Hemp Papers: Known for their durability and slow, even burn rate, hemp papers are a popular, eco-friendly choice that imparts minimal flavor.
  • Rice Papers: Often ultra-thin and made from processed rice, these papers are prized for producing a clean, pure smoking experience with almost no aftertaste. They can be tricky for beginners to handle due to their delicate nature.
  • Wood Pulp Papers: These are the classic, traditional rolling papers. They are generally thicker and easier to handle, making them a popular choice for beginners, though they may burn faster and add a slight paper taste.
  • Flax Papers: Made from the flax plant, these papers are silky, thin, and burn slowly, offering a smooth experience similar to rice papers.

Understanding these differences is the first step toward choosing the right rolling paper to enhance your smoking sessions.

Merkmale und Vorteile

Choosing the right rolling paper is more than just a matter of preference; it can affect the taste, burn rate, and even your health. Here’s what to consider when exploring different rolling paper brands:

  • Material: As discussed, papers come in a variety of materials, including hemp, rice, and wood pulp. Each material offers a unique smoking experience, with unbleached, organic hemp often being touted as one of the best rolling papers for health.
  • Thickness: The thickness of rolling papers can impact the burn rate and the amount of smoke produced. Thinner papers, like rice paper, tend to offer a more flavorful experience with less paper smoke, while thicker papers may be easier for beginners to handle.
  • Flavor: Some rolling papers are infused with flavors, which can enhance your smoking session. However, it’s essential to ensure these flavors come from natural sources if health is a priority.
  • Adhesive: The "gum" line on a rolling paper is what seals the joint. Most quality brands use natural gums, such as acacia gum, which is tasteless and non-toxic.
  • Eco-Friendliness: As more people become conscious of their environmental impact, many brands are now offering organic and unbleached options, contributing to a healthier choice for both you and the planet.

With these features in mind, you’ll be better prepared to select the best rolling papers 2025 has to offer, focusing on both quality and health. Health Considerations

When choosing rolling papers, health should be a primary concern. Many mass-produced, cheaper rolling papers may contain added chemicals, bleach, or other additives that can produce harmful toxins when burned. Opting for papers made from organic materials with a focus on health benefits is key to a safer smoking experience.

Look for papers that are explicitly labeled as "unbleached," "organic," or "chlorine-free." Unbleached papers have a natural, light brown color and ensure you are not inhaling the byproducts of industrial bleaching agents. Brands that prioritize natural materials, such as pure hemp or rice straw, are generally considered healthier choices. By prioritizing these health-conscious options, you can enjoy your smoking sessions with greater peace of mind.

FAQs

1. Are RAW papers good for you?

RAW papers are often considered a healthier option because they are made from natural, unrefined plant materials (like hemp) and use a natural tree sap gumline. They contain no burn additives, chlorine, or other harsh chemicals, which makes them a popular choice among health-conscious smokers.

2. What are the different types of rolling papers?

The most common types of rolling papers are categorized by material: hemp, rice, wood pulp, and flax. They also come in flavored and unflavored varieties. Each type offers unique characteristics in terms of taste, burn rate, and ease of rolling, allowing users to choose based on their preferences.

3. How do I know if a rolling paper is safe to use?

To ensure safety, look for papers that are free from bleach, GMOs, chlorine, and synthetic additives. Many reputable brands advertise their products as "organic," "unbleached," or "natural," which can indicate a healthier choice. Transparency in materials and manufacturing processes is a good sign of a quality, safety-conscious brand.

4. What is the best thickness for rolling papers?

The best thickness often depends on personal preference. Thinner papers (like rice or fine hemp papers) provide a more pure flavor of the herb with less paper smoke. However, thicker options (like some wood pulp papers) may be easier for beginners to handle and roll without tearing. Experimenting with both can help you determine what you enjoy most.
